As nouns, leptosporangium is a hyponym of spore case; that is, leptosporangium is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than spore case:
  • spore case: organ containing or producing spores
  • leptosporangium: a sporangium formed from a single epidermal cell; characteristic of the Filicales or of almost all modern ferns
